Free SHOWTIME festival in Enfield Town today
9:17am Friday 31st August 2012 in News By Hermione Wright
Four million volts of electricity will be pumped through Enfield Town today during a free arts show.
Performers The Lords of Lightning will use lightning-style displays as part of their act during the SHOWTIME festival.
Thirty acts will perform in Enfield Town Park, Library Green and Enfield Town High Street between 4pm and 9pm.
The festival is part of the London 2012 Festival to celebrate the Olympic and Paralympic games.
Councillor Bambos Charalambous, Enfield Council’s cabinet member for culture, leisure, youth and localism, said: “Enfield Council is excited to host such an amazing event in our beautiful Town Park, at Library Green, and along the high street in Enfield Town.
“We welcome families to come down to this free event to start the Autumn Show weekend off with a bang.”
